Figure 1
Quantum efficiency of PILATUS4 CdTe for photon energies in the range 8 keV to 100 keV, with threshold set to 50% of the photon energy. The two jumps in the QE data at the K absorption edges of Cd (26.7 keV) and Te (31.8 keV) are caused by fluorescence escapes occurring for photon energies above the absorption edges. The QE was determined using a Monte Carlo simulation code (Trueb et al., 2017BB31).
